Data labeling is the process of tagging raw data—such as images, text, or videos—with meaningful annotations that help AI models recognize patterns. A well-trained AI model relies on properly labeled datasets to learn and generalize from real-world inputs. The absence of accurate data labeling can lead to biased or incorrect predictions, reducing model reliability.
AI models are only as good as the data they learn from. Poorly labeled data introduces noise, leading to misclassification and unreliable outputs. A high-quality data labeling platform ensures that annotations are precise, reducing the risk of errors and enhancing model performance.
In computer vision, AI models analyze and interpret visual data. From facial recognition to medical imaging, accurate annotations are critical. High-quality data labeling helps AI distinguish between objects, detect anomalies, and improve recognition tasks. For example, autonomous vehicles rely on labeled images to identify pedestrians, traffic signs, and road conditions.
Bias in AI models often stems from inconsistent or imbalanced labeling. A well-managed data labeling platform ensures diversity in training datasets, minimizing bias and promoting fairness in AI decision-making. This is particularly important in applications like hiring algorithms or loan approval systems, where biased models can lead to unfair outcomes.
